Teenagers arrested after boy stabbed in Paston released without charge
Two teenagers arrested after a stabbing in Paston have been released without charge.

A boy was taken to Peterborough City Hospital after the incident in Sheepwalk, Paston, yesterday afternoon (Tuesday).
Cambridgeshire police were called about the incident at 2.48pm and searched the area with the police helicopter.

Two teenagers were arrested on suspicion of causing grievous bodily harm (GBH) with intent but have now been released without charge.
